Maiden North America has an Enterprise Value (EV) of 1.93B.
n/a
n/a
n/a
n/a
Financial Position
0
0
n/a
n/a
n/a
undefined
Financial Efficiency
Return on Equity is n/a and Return on Invested Capital is 29.93%.
n/a
n/a
29.93%
n/a
n/a
undefined
n/a
n/a
Taxes
557K
0%
Stock Price Statistics
The stock price has increased by null% in the
last 52 weeks. The beta is 0.53, so Maiden North America's
price volatility has been higher than the market average.
0.53
n/a
17.01
17.54
51.99
n/a
Income Statement
In the last 12 months, Maiden North America had revenue of 58.13M
and earned 55.43M
in profits. Earnings per share was 0.64.